Assessing the Damage
Before starting any restoration work, a thorough assessment of the damage is paramount. Inspect the railings for signs of rust, cracks, or any other structural issues. This step helps you understand the extent of the work required and plan your approach accordingly.

Rust, for instance, can be categorized into different types based on its severity. Light rust can be removed with basic cleaning and sanding, while heavy rust may require more intensive methods, such as sandblasting or chemical stripping. Similarly, minor cracks can be repaired using specialized epoxy fillers, while extensive damage might necessitate replacing entire sections of the railing.
Preparation of the Surface

Once you've assessed the damage, the next step is to prepare the surface for restoration. This involves removing any loose rust, dirt, and debris. For light rust, a wire brush or a scraper can be used. For heavier rust, you might need to employ sandblasting or chemical stripping.
After removing the rust, clean the surface thoroughly using a suitable cleaning solution. This could be a simple mixture of water and detergent or a specialized cleaner designed for cast iron. Ensure you rinse the surface thoroughly to remove any residue that could interfere with the restoration process.
Repairing Structural Damage

With the surface prepared, the next step is to repair any structural damage. For minor cracks, apply a specialized epoxy filler designed for cast iron. These fillers are typically applied in layers, with each layer being allowed to cure before applying the next. Once the filler has cured completely, sand it smooth using progressively finer grit sandpaper.
For more extensive damage, you might need to replace entire sections of the railing. This involves cutting out the damaged section using a reciprocating saw or a hacksaw, then welding in a new section. Ensure the new section matches the original design and is properly aligned with the existing railing.
Restoration Techniques

After repairing any structural damage, the next step is to restore the railing's finish. This involves several techniques, each with its own advantages and disadvantages.
One popular method is painting. This involves applying a primer to protect the iron from further corrosion, followed by several coats of paint. Painting is relatively inexpensive and can be done in a wide range of colors. However, it requires regular maintenance to prevent the paint from chipping or peeling.


















Hot Blackening
Another restoration technique is hot blackening, also known as black oxide coating. This involves immersing the railing in a bath of molten salt or a chemical solution at high temperatures. The process creates a black, corrosion-resistant layer on the surface of the iron. Hot blackening provides excellent protection against rust and gives the railing a distinctive, aged appearance. However, it's a more expensive process than painting and may not be suitable for all types of cast iron.
Hot blackening is typically followed by a clear coat or a wax seal to protect the finish and enhance its durability. This step is crucial as it prevents the black oxide layer from being damaged by moisture or other environmental factors.
